New Delhi: Former Delhi chief minister Sheila Dikshit Monday gave her "best wishes" to the AAP and asked the party to fulfil the promises it made to the people.
"Our best wishes to them to fulfil their promises. We gave outside support to them to form (a) government and will continue to give support till they fulfil the promises," Dikshit told the media.
Her comments came as Aam Aadmi Party leader Arvind Kejriwal announced his party will form the government in Delhi.
The AAP won 28 seats in the 70-member assembly and is taking power with the support of eight Congress legislators.
"We know the promises (they made) are difficult to fulfill," said Dikshit, who was defeated by Kejriwal in her New Delhi constituency by over 25,000 votes.
